For a national media, there are a lot of question marks on the team.  From their perspective, I think these are reasonable question marks:
-MU lost a first round pick and two starting guards.  All three barely saw the bench.
-There are only two starters coming back, and two other guys who got more than 10 mins off the bench
-DJO and Jimmy were inconsistent at times, and maybe people will figure out how to guard them
-Buycks and Fulce played, but were inconsistent
-Who plays point guard?
-Who rebounds in Hayward's absense?
-How will Buzz do without Crean's players for the first time?
-Is Buzz a flash in the pan early like a Quinn Snyder at Mizzou or Mike Davis at Indiana?
-How will a team with no upperclass players who were top 100 recruits fair?
-How good are any of these 4-star players who are all underclassmen?  Will they even be able to contribute?

We all have plenty of reason to be excited because we have all seen how good Butler and DJO are.  But the national media is not following Junior's progress in the pro-am or Otule's development.  I think this is one of the better teams we have had but understand how the national media would question MU.
